Joseph Gorski Obituary

JAFFREY - Joseph J. Gorski, 93, of Jaffrey died peacefully on Saturday July 19, 2014 at the Good Shepherd Rehabilitation Center following a period of failing health.

He was born on April 4, 1921 in Lowell Mass., son of the late Jacob and Kunegunda (Przybyla) Gorski. When he was a young boy, Mr. Gorski's family moved to West Peterborough where he spent his formative years and attended the former Peterborough High School. He had lived in Peterborough for most of his life until moving to Barefoot Bay, Fla. for seven years and in Jaffrey since 1997. Mr. Gorski had lived in Jaffrey since the death of his wife in 2004.

During World War II he served with the United States Army as a Medic with the 1st Army Division. He was awarded the Purple Heart as well as the Bronze Star, for his service in Africa, Sicily, Northern France, Rhineland as well as the Normandy Beach invasion where he was in the first wave landing on Omaha Beach, Easy Red. He was a member of the LeClair, Caron, Pelletier American Legion Post #13 of Greenville.

Mr. Gorski had worked as a mechanic for more than forty years at the New Hampshire Ball Bearing Company in Peterborough. He retired in 1987. He was a member of the Knights of Columbus Monadnock Council #5790 of Peterborough. He enjoyed golf, bowling and traveling. Through the years, he and his wife had traveled to Hawaii, Africa and Mexico.

He married the former Jeanette T. LaFortune in Winchendon, Mass. on Jan. 19, 1946.

She died May 9, 2004 in Florida. Mr. Gorski was also predeceased by two sisters Stella Vallaincourt and Jenny Vallaincourt.

He is survived by his son, Stephen Gorski and his wife, Donna of New Ipswich; his daughter, Cheryl Christian and her husband, Gerald of Dublin; three grandchildren; three step grandchildren; three great grandchildren; and many nieces, nephews cousins and friends.
